Frequently Asked Questions

What is the main advantage of green lasers on firearms?

Green lasers offer superior visibility compared to red lasers, especially in bright light conditions. They appear brighter and 'pop' more effectively against various backgrounds, making them more reliable for defensive use.

Which Smith & Wesson firearm lines now feature integrated Crimson Trace lasers?

Smith & Wesson has integrated Crimson Trace lasers across their M&P line, including full-size and compact models in 9mm and .40 caliber. They also offer them on the Bodyguard 380 and the Shield pistol.

Why did Smith & Wesson choose Crimson Trace for their integrated lasers?

Smith & Wesson partnered with Crimson Trace due to their reputation for durability and reliability. Crimson Trace has also developed technology to ensure reasonable battery life for their green laser systems.

Can I purchase Smith & Wesson firearms with these lasers already installed?

Yes, Smith & Wesson firearms with integrated Crimson Trace lasers are available for order directly from your dealer. They come ready to go with the laser system pre-installed.
